              <title language="eng">Evaluation of the hypocholesterolemic efficacy of lyophilized nerium oleander distillate</title>

              <affiliationsList><affiliationName affiliationId="1">Selcuk University, Health Science Institute, Department of Pharmacology and Toxicology, Konya, Turkey</affiliationName><affiliationName affiliationId="2">Selcuk University, Veterinary Faculty, Department of Pharmacology and Toxicology, Konya, Turkey</affiliationName><affiliationName affiliationId="3">Ankara University, Medicine Faculty, Department of Pathophysiology, Internal Medicine, Ankara,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im:&lt;/b&gt; The purpose of this study was to assess the effect of administering
Nerium oleander distillate on hypercholesterolemic rats&#039; serum biochemical
parameters.&lt;p&gt;
&lt;b&gt;Materials and Methods:&lt;/b&gt; Three equal groups of 30 male Sprague-Dawley
rats were formed. No application was made for the control group. The second
group received a high cholesterol diet, while the third group received a
high cholesterol diet in addition to lyophilized Nerium oleander distillate by
oral gavage once daily. After three months, blood was drawn after sedation
and they were euthanized. Serum fasting blood glucose, triglyceride, highdensity
lipoprotein, total cholesterol, low-density lipoprotein, alanine
aminotransferase, aspartate aminotransferase, albumin, and total protein
levels, as well as alkaline phosphatase, lactate dehydrogenase, creatinine, and
urea levels, were determined using an autoanalyzer.&lt;p&gt;
&lt;b&gt;Results:&lt;/b&gt; Alkaline phosphatase, alanine aminotransferase, aspartate
aminotransferase, cholesterol, glucose, low-density lipoprotein, and
triglyceride levels increased (p &lt; 0.05) in the group fed a high cholesterol diet
compared to the control group, but Nerium oleander treatment decreased the
elevated aspartate aminotransferase, cholesterol, low-density lipoprotein,
and triglyceride (p &lt; 0.05).&lt;p&gt;
&lt;b&gt;Conclusion:&lt;/b&gt; To summarize, it can be stated that Nerium oleander distillate has
antihypercholesterolemic and liver-protective properties.</abstract>

              <title language="eng">Expression of dna methyltransferases (dnmts) at mrna level in ovine endometrium during estrus cycle and early pregnancy</title>

              <affiliationsList><affiliationName affiliationId="1">Kastamonu University, Veterinary Faculty, Department of Genetic, Kastamonu, Turkey</affiliationName><affiliationName affiliationId="2">Dicle University, Veterinary Faculty, Department of Obstetrics and Gynaecology, Dicle,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im: &lt;/b&gt;To elucidate mRNA expression of DNA methyltransferase enzyme genes
(DNMT1, DNMT3A, and DNMT3B) in ovine endometrium whether they are
modulated during the estrus cycle and early pregnancy.&lt;p&gt;
&lt;b&gt;Materials and Methods:&lt;/b&gt; The endometrial samples including intercaruncular
sites was obtained from a total of 24 ewes on days of 12 (P12, n = 4), 16 (P16,
n = 4) and 22 (P22, n = 4) of pregnancy following mating and cyclic days of
12 (C12, n = 4), 16 (C16, n = 4) and 22 (C22, n = 4) of the estrous cycle. The
relative mRNA level of DNMTs were evaluated through real-time quantitative
RT-qPCR.&lt;p&gt;
&lt;b&gt;Results: &lt;/b&gt;Abundances of DNMTs including DNMT1, DNMT3A, and DNMT3B
were detected during the estrous cycle and early pregnancy in the ovine
endometrium by this study. DNMT1 mRNA steady-state level was greater in
P16 than in C16 whereas they did not change within the rest of the groups. The
level of DNMT3A mRNA, during early pregnancy, had the highest expression
levels on P12 compared to P22 and P16 (p&lt;0.01). However, the level of
DNMT3A mRNA was lower in P16 than in C16 (p&lt;0.01) and had a similar
decrease in P22 compared to C22 (p&lt;0.01). DNMT3B mRNA level did not
differ (p&gt;0.01) during the estrus cycle and early pregnancy.&lt;p&gt;
&lt;b&gt;Conclusion: &lt;/b&gt;DNA methylation related DNMTs may be required to control of
gene expression in the ovine endometrium during the estrus cycle and early
pregnancy.</abstract>

              <title language="eng">Histopathological evaluation of the effects of thymoquinone and resveratrol on the liver in rats administered doxorubicin</title>

              <affiliationsList><affiliationName affiliationId="1">Selcuk University, Veterinary Faculty, Department of Pathology, Konya, Turkey</affiliationName><affiliationName affiliationId="2">Erciyes University, Veterinary Faculty, Department of Reproduction and Artificial Insemination, Kayseri, Turkey</affiliationName><affiliationName affiliationId="3">Selcuk University, Veterinary Faculty, Department of Reproduction and Artificial Insemination, Konya,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im: &lt;/b&gt;The purpose was to investigate the effects of various dosages of
thymoquinone and resveratrol (5 and 20 mg/kg) on doxorubicin-induced
hepatotoxicity in rats from a pathological standpoint.&lt;p&gt;
&lt;b&gt;Materials and Methods:&lt;/b&gt; Eighty male Wistar Albino rats were used in
this study. Animals were divided in to 10 groups: Control (physiological
saline, PO); Doxorubicin (physiological saline, PO and Dox,15mg/kg Dox in
10th days, IP); Thymoquinone -5 (TQ-5, 5 mg/kg TQ, PO); TQ-20 (20 mg/
kg TQ, PO); Resveratrol-5 (Res-5, 5 mg/kg Res, PO); Res-20 (20 mg/kg Res,
PO); Dox+TQ-5 ; Dox+TQ-20; Dox+Res-5; Dox+Res-20. After the 21-day
experiment, 6 replicates were randomly selected from the groups. After
weighing the body weight, the livers of the euthanized rats were dissected
and weighed. Routine tissue processing processes were applied to liver
samples. Hepatocyte degeneration, necrosis/apoptosis, bile duct hyperplasia,
dissociation, congestion, karyomegaly, mononuclear cell infiltration, binuclear
hepatocytes, and mitosis were all examined microscopically, and a liver total
lesion score was calculated&lt;p&gt;
&lt;b&gt;Results:&lt;/b&gt; Dox treatment increased relative liver weight, but the TQ and Res
groups prevented this increase (p&lt;0.05). The liver total lesion score, which
increased with Dox, was shown to be lower in the TQ and Res groups (p&lt;0.05).
However, the Dox+TQ-5, Dox+TQ-20, and Dox+Res-20 groups, showed no
amelioration in necrosis/apoptosis.&lt;p&gt;
&lt;b&gt;Conclusion: &lt;/b&gt;TQ and Res (5 and 20 mg/kg) decreased the total liver lesion
score induced by Dox. Although TQ and RES diminish degeneration and
inflammation, their poor protective effects on necrosis/apoptosis, one of the
key criteria, were considered as a limiting cause for their uncontrolled usage.</abstract>

              <title language="eng">Investigation of the efficacy of tyrosol on doxorubicin-induced acute cardiotoxicity in rats</title>

              <affiliationsList><affiliationName affiliationId="1">Hatay Mustafa Kemal University, Veterinary Faculty, Department of Physiology, Hatay,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im:&lt;/b&gt; In this study, it was aimed to investigate the efficacy of tyrosol on
cardiotoxicity induced by doxorubicin.&lt;p&gt;
&lt;b&gt;Materials and Methods:&lt;/b&gt; Rats were divided into 4 groups and each group
included 8 rats. Groups 1 and 2 were given 1 ml of physiological saline,
while groups 3 and 4 were given 20 mg/kg of tyrosol. In saline and tyrosol
administrations, the oral gavage method was used. In addition, a single dose
of 15 mg/kg dose of doxorubicin was administered intraperitoneally to group
2 and group 4 on the 12th day of the trial. On the 14th day of the experiment,
serum and tissue samples were taken from the anesthetized rats and then
euthanized. Serum creatine kinase MB and creatine kinase activities were
analyzed. Heart tissues were extracted, and histological and oxidative stress
characteristics were measured in these tissues. Heart tissue malondialdehyde
and reduced glutathione levels, catalase and glutathione peroxidase activities
were assessed spectrophotometrically.&lt;p&gt;
&lt;b&gt;Results: &lt;/b&gt;Tyrosol pretreatment inhibited doxorubicin-induced increase
in heart tissue malondialdehyde level (p&lt;0.05), the decrease in reduced
glutathione level and glutathione peroxidase enzyme activity, and suppressed
doxorubicin-induced oxidative stress in the heart tissue. In terms of cardiac
tissue catalase enzyme activity, no differences were found between the
groups. Because of the reduction in oxidative damage in the heart, the serum
creatine kinase MB and creatine kinase activity decreased dramatically
(p&lt;0.05). Furthermore, it was discovered that tyrosol pretreatment reduced
the histopathological lesions caused by doxorubicin in cardiac tissue.&lt;p&gt;
&lt;b&gt;Conclusion:&lt;/b&gt; It is thought that the administration of tyrosol may reduce the
cardiotoxicity caused by doxorubicin.</abstract>

              <title language="eng">Evaluation of bacterial translocation in cats undergoing laparotomy</title>

              <affiliationsList><affiliationName affiliationId="1">Selcuk University, Veterinary Faculty, Department of Surgery, Konya, Turkey</affiliationName><affiliationName affiliationId="2">Dicle University, Veterinary Faculty, Department of Surgery, Diyarbakır, Turkey</affiliationName><affiliationName affiliationId="3">Dicle University, Veterinary Faculty, Department of Microbiology, Diyarbakır,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im: &lt;/b&gt;This study aimed to evaluate the presence of bacterial translocation (BT)
in cats undergoing laparotomy procedures for pathologies that are thought to
increase intra-abdominal pressure or pressurize the intestinal wall.&lt;p&gt;
&lt;b&gt;Materials and Methods:&lt;/b&gt; Twenty-five cats were evaluated that refered
to Selcuk University Animal Hospital for laparotomy after the clinical,
laboratory, ultrasonographic and radiographic examinations. Sterile swab
samples were taken from the peritoneal fluid and an appropriate mesenteric
lymph nodes (MLN) immediately after reaching the abdominal region
during the laparatomy. Identification of bacterial strains was carried out and
bacterial spectra were analyzed. Antibiotic resistance of bacterial strains was
determined by the Kirby-Bauer disc diffusion method.&lt;p&gt;
&lt;b&gt;Results:&lt;/b&gt; BT was diagnosed in 4 (16%) of 25 cats as a result of deteriorated
intestinal perfusion due to foreign body. It was determined that 2 of the BT
were isolated from swap samples taken from only MLNs and 2 of them were
isolated from swap samples taken from both the peritoneal cavity and MLNs.
It was determined that 50% of the bacteria growing in the peritoneum were
E. faecalis (n=2) and 50% were E. faecium. It was determined that the bacteria
growing in the MLNs formed P. fluorescens and E. faecalis.&lt;p&gt;
&lt;b&gt;Conclusion:&lt;/b&gt; BT should be considered in the presence of pathologies that
affect intra-abdominal pressure or affect the intestinal wall. It is thought that
the suspicion of bacterial translocation should increase in pathologies that
directly affect the intestinal wall. It is thought that the use of specific antibiotics
will be more positive in terms of prognosis by performing an antibiogram.</abstract>

              <title language="eng">Comparison of growth curves with non-linear models in japanese quails of different plumage color</title>

              <affiliationsList><affiliationName affiliationId="1">Selcuk University, Veterinary Faculty, Department of Animal Science, Konya, Turkey</affiliationName><affiliationName affiliationId="2">Afyon Kocatepe University, Veterinary Faculty, Department of Medical Biology and Genetics, Afyonkarahisar,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im:&lt;/b&gt; In this study, it was aimed to estimate growth curve parameters and to
determine the best fit model in brown and yellow plumage-colored Japanese
quails.&lt;p&gt;
&lt;b&gt;Materials and Methods:&lt;/b&gt; 80 brown and 80 yellow plumage-colored Japanese
quails were used as research material. The quails were weighed 0th, 7th, 14th,
21st, 28th, 35th and 42nd days of age. Gompertz, Logistic, Von Bertalanffy and
Richards models were used to determine growth curves.&lt;p&gt;
&lt;b&gt;Results:&lt;/b&gt; According to the goodness of fit the Gompertz model was determined
the best model for both brown and yellow plumage-colored Japanese quails.
Coefficient of Determination (R&lt;sup&gt;2&lt;/sup&gt;), Adjusted Coefficient of Determination
(R&lt;sup&gt;2&lt;/sup&gt;
&lt;sub&gt;adj&lt;/sub&gt;), Akaike Information Criteria (AIC), Bayesian Information Criteria (BIC)
and mean square errors (MSE) were determined 0,9968; 0,9952; 24,8801;
24,7179 and 25,9657 for brown; 0,9975; 0,9963; 22,9149; 22,7527 and
19,6099 for yellow plumage-colored quails, respectively. Parameter ?&lt;sub&gt;0&lt;/sub&gt;, ?&lt;sub&gt;1&lt;/sub&gt; and
?&lt;sub&gt;2&lt;/sub&gt; of the model were found 234,89; 3,630; 0,072 &amp; 236,58; 3,516 and 0,069,
respectively. The age at point of inflection and weight at point of inflection
were calculated 17,91 d and 86,41 g; 18,15 d and 87,03 g for brown and yellow
plumage-colored quails, respectively.&lt;p&gt;
&lt;b&gt;Conclusion:&lt;/b&gt; In conclusion, Gompertz model was determined the best model
in this study. This model can be advised to determine the growth curve traits
in further researches for different plumage-colored Japanese quails. Morever,
Jumbo quail breeding which is a sub-variate of Japanese quail must be
considered by quail meat production due to the high maturity index besides
the brown plumage-colored Japanese quails.</abstract>

              <title language="eng">Determination of the correlations between the morphological characteristics and metapodial radiometric measurements of awassi sheep</title>

              <affiliationsList><affiliationName affiliationId="1">Harran University, Veterinary Faculty, Department of Animal Science, Şanlıurfa, Turkey</affiliationName><affiliationName affiliationId="2">Harran University, Veterinary Faculty, Department of Anatomy, Şanlıurfa, Turkey</affiliationName><affiliationName affiliationId="3">Istanbul University, Cerrahpaşa Veterinary Faculty, Department of Anatomy, İstanbul,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im:&lt;/b&gt; The study aims to determine the correlations between external
structural characteristics and osteometric data of Awassi sheep.&lt;p&gt;
&lt;b&gt;Materials and Methods:&lt;/b&gt; A total of 150 heads Awassi sheep (18-20 months
of age), 100 females and 50 males were used in the study. After determining
the sex and measuring the body weight, wither height, ridge height, rump
height, rump width and rump length, sternum height, body length, shin
circumference, bicostal diameter, chest circumference and pelvis width of
sheep, metapodium radiographs were taken by digital mobile X-ray device
with DR system.&lt;p&gt;
&lt;b&gt;Results:&lt;/b&gt; Between the values GL, Bp, SD, Bd, Be, WCL for metacarpus and GL,
Bp, SD, Bd, Be, WCM, WCL and CM for metatarsus, sexual dimorphism was
statistically significant when the radiometric measurement values of the
metapodiums are examined (p &lt; 0.001). The highest correlation value for the
front leg was found between the GL value from the radiometry measurements
of the metacarpal bones and the back height from the external structure
measurement values (r: 0.684) when the correlation between metapodial
radiometry and external structure features were examined. The highest
correlation value for the hind limb was found between the SD value from the
radiometric measurements of the metatarsal bones and the back height from
the external structure measurement values (r: 0.679).&lt;p&gt;
&lt;b&gt;Conclusion:&lt;/b&gt; Metapodiums, which they complete their development early in
the body had strong relationships with the body measurements. The results
obtained from the study show that metapodial radiometric features have the
potential to be used in selection studies in terms of growth and meat yield.</abstract>

              <title language="eng">Evaluation of relationships between dogs and owners: the turkish translation, reliability and validity study of cat/dog owner relationship scale (c/dors)</title>

              <affiliationsList><affiliationName affiliationId="1">Hatay Mustafa Kemal University, Veterinary Faculty, Department of Biostatistics, Hatay, Turkey</affiliationName><affiliationName affiliationId="2">Ankara University, Veterinary Faculty, Department of Biostatistics, Ankara, Turkey</affiliationName><affiliationName affiliationId="3">Ankara University, Veterinary Faculty, Department of Obstetrics and Gynecology, Ankara, Turkey</affiliationName><affiliationName affiliationId="4">Pet 312 Veterinary Clinic, Ankara,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im:&lt;/b&gt; The aim of this study was to translate the cat/dog owner relationship
scale (C/DORS), which can be used to assess the quality of relationships
between dogs and their owners, into Turkish and to evaluate relationship
quality across different demographic variables in Turkey.&lt;p&gt;
&lt;b&gt;Materials and Methods: &lt;/b&gt;An expert team translated the cat/dog owner
relationship scale (C/DORS) from its original language of English into Turkish.
Information was collected from dog owners who volunteered to participate in
the study via a scale. The dog owners&#039; gender, educational status, and financial
level were also collected. The validity and reliability of the scale were assessed
using Cronbach&#039;s alpha and factor analysis.&lt;p&gt;
&lt;b&gt;Results:&lt;/b&gt; The initial statistical analyses revealed that factor analysis could be
used on the scale (Bartlett?s sphericity test, p&lt;0,001) and that the sample size
was adequate (KMO test=0,619). The total variance explained by the scale that
has three subscales as perceived emotional closeness, pet-owner interaction
and perceived cost was found to be 43,90%. The Cronbach&#039;s alpha coefficient
of the scale was found to be 0.844. It was observed that the subscale scores of
the scale were at similar levels in terms of gender (p&gt;0,05) and income statue
(p&gt;0,05). Perceived cost subscale score was statistically significant in terms of
educational status (p&lt;0,05).&lt;p&gt;
&lt;b&gt;Conclusion:&lt;/b&gt; It is thought that this scale, that has been adapted into Turkish
and whose validity-reliability has been determined, is the first scale that
can measure dog-owner relationships in Turkey. In addition, this study will
encourage the examination of pet-human relationships in Turkey through
with scale development and adaptation studies.</abstract>

              <title language="eng">Histopathological investigation of the effect of coenzyme q10 on intestinal mucosa and tight junction proteins in experimental colitis model</title>

              <affiliationsList><affiliationName affiliationId="1">İzmir Bakırçay University, Medicine Faculty, Department of Histology and Embryology, İzmir, Turkey</affiliationName><affiliationName affiliationId="2">Gazi University, Pharmacy Faculty, Department of Basic Pharmaceutical Sciences, Ankara, Turkey</affiliationName></affiliationsList><abstract language="eng">&lt;b&gt;Aim:&lt;/b&gt; The purpose of this study is to investigate the effect of Coenzyme Q10
(CoQ10) on the mucosa, goblet cell density and tight junction (TJ) proteins in
the acetic acid-induced colitis model in rats.&lt;p&gt;
&lt;b&gt;Materials and Methods:&lt;/b&gt; Twenty-four,10-week-old female Wistar albino rats
were used in the study and divided into 3 groups; Control(n=4), Colitis (n=10)
and Colitis+ CoQ10 (n=10). The colitis model was induced with 4% acetic acid.
One day after colitis induction, CoQ10 was administered to the Colitis+CoQ10
group by gavage (30 mg/kg/day) for 10 days. After the treatment, the
sacrification of the experimental animals was carried out. The macroscopic
evaluation was performed. Microscopic scoring and goblet cell density by
staining sections with Masson?s Trichrome and Alcian blue; TJ proteins were
also evaluated by immunohistochemical analyzes of Occludin (Occ), Zonula
Ocludens-1 (ZO-1), and Claudin-1 (Cl-1).&lt;p&gt;
&lt;b&gt;Results:&lt;/b&gt; Macroscopic and microscopic scoring of colon tissues belonging
to the colitis group showed a statistically significant increase compared
to the control group (p&lt;0.05). In the colitis+CoQ10 group, macroscopic
and histopathological damage decreased significantly (p&lt;0.05), and the
percentage of Alcian blue staining area and the goblet cell density increased
statistically with CoQ10 compared to the colitis group (p&lt;0.05). It was also
noted that there was an increase in the immunoreactivity of TJ proteins, which
are important in the integrity of the mucosal barrier.&lt;p&gt;
&lt;b&gt;Conclusion:&lt;/b&gt; CoQ10 showed a positive effect on histopathological changes
and tight junction proteins in acetic acid-induced colitis model. However, it
is thought that more detailed and various experimental and clinical studies
supported by advanced molecular techniques are needed on the protective
effects of CoQ10 against ulcerative colitis patients.</abstract>
